Yellow Bird of Paradise
Semi-deciduous shrub or small tree with fern-like foliage divided into tiny leaflets. Clusters of yellow flowers with long bright red stamens bloom all summer.
Caesalpinia gilliesii (Poinciana g.)
Leaf Characteristics
Leaf notes : Foliage consists of numerous leaflets up to 3/8" long.
Leaf texture : Fern-like
Leaf length : 8"
Leaf shape : Compund
Leaf color : Mid to dark green
Flower Characteristics
Flower notes : Bloom in clusters of up to 40 flowers.
Flower width : 1 1/2"
Flower color : Yellow
Plant Anatomy
Foliage growth cycle : Semi-deciduous
Average size maturity width : 8 ft.
Average size maturity height : 10 ft.
Growth rate : Vigorous
Cultural Information
USDA Zone : 20 to 25 F (Z9a)
Sunset zone : 8-16, 18-24
Water requirements : Moderate
Light exposure : Sun
